I haven’t really found an oatmeal recipe that my children enjoyed eating, until now! Of course add peanut butter and chocolate chips to almost anything and it will be yummy. I took Janelle’s original recipe from Gluten Freely Frugal and adjusted it, thanks Janelle!
Ingredients:
1 3/4 Cups Brown Sugar or 1 Cup of Honey
5 Cups Oats
2 Tbls Baking Powder
1/2 Teas Salt
3 Eggs Beaten
1 Cup of Melted Butter or 1 Cup of Coconut Oil
1-3/4 Cups Milk
1 Cup of Peanut Butter
1/2 Cup of Chocolate Chips
Directions:
First preheat your oven to 375 degrees. Mix all your dry ingredients together. Next add in your wet ingredients. Stir well. Lastly add the chocolate chips and mix through. Spread into a 9×13 pan. Bake about 45-50 minutes until the top is nice and crispy. Serve warm with milk poured over or with milk on the side.
